Traditional assessment |
Conventional methods of testing Examinees answer questions and respond in writing tests and inventories |
|
|
Psychological Educational |
2 Types of tests accdg to purpose |
|
|
Psychological test |
Type of test accdg to purpose Measure a student's intangible aspects of behavior |
|
|
Educational test |
Measure results/fx of instruction Provide empirical info on students' achievement levels Identify and analyze variations on achievement levels |
|
|
National achievement test |
Example of educational test |
NAT |
|
Survey Mastery |
2 Types of tests accdg to scope |
|
|
Survey test |
Type of test accdg to scope Measure students' general level of achievement of broad learning outcomes Emphasize norm-referenced interpretations |
|
|
Mastery |
Type of tests accdg to scope Measure degree of _ of a limited learning outcomes Typically use criterion-related interpretations |
|
|
Verbal Nonverbal |
2 Types of tests accdg to language mode |
|
|
Verbal |
Type of tests accdg to language mode Questions using language to measure a learning domain/psychological construct |
|
|
Nonverbal |
Type of tests accdg to language mode Questions in diagrammatic and pictorial form For intelligence and aptitude testing |
|
|
Speed Power |
2 Types of tests accdg to speed |
|
|
Speed |
Type of tests accdg to speed Rigid time limits Relatively easy items Within same level of difficulty |
|
|
Power |
Type of tests accdg to speed Measure level of perf under sufficient time Items increasing difficulty |
|
|
Standardized Teacher-made |
2 Types of tests accdg to construction |
|
|
Standardized |
Type of tests accdg to construction By professionals/experts |
|
|
Teacher-made |
Type of test accdg to construction By tchrs to assess student learning concerning classroom activities |
|
|
Group-administered Individually-administered |
2 Types of tests accdg to test admin |
|
|
Grp-administered |
Type of tests accdg to test admin To a grp of indivs Most educ tests |
|
|
Individually-administered |
Type of tests accdg to test admin One-to-one basis using careful questioning Most Personality and psychological tests |
|
|
Objective Subjective |
2 Types of tests accdg to scoring manner |
|
|
objectiVe |
Type of tests accdg to scoring manner Right or wrong ex. Selected -response typ |
|
|
Subjective |
Types of tests accdg to scoring manner More open-ended, require interpretation |
|
|
Norm-referenced Criterion-referenced |
2 Types of tests accdg to basis for interpretation |
|
|
Norm-referenced |
Type of tests accdg to basis for interpretation Compare scores among students |
|
|
Criterion-referenced |
Type of tests accdg to basis for interpretation Compare student's core w/subjective and predetermined standards Test score conveys level of competence in a defined criterion domain directly |
|
|
Selected-response tests Constructed-response |
2 Types of tests accdg to test formats |
|
|
Selected-response |
Types of tests accdg to test formats student selects correct answer from given choices |
|
|
Constructed-response |
Type of tests accdg to test formats Requires student to compose responses |
